Does a Will need updated to reflect changes in the lat names of the beneficiaries?

Name changes due to marriage.

A codocil is an amendment to a Will.  It is not necessary to file an amendment to the Will for a name change as long as the beneficiaries can be identified.  If the beneficiaries in the Will are identified by their original name and date of birth, that should be sufficient.  Otherwise, whenever there is a marriage or divorce and the name changes, there would be amendments to the Will.  As long as the beneficiaries can be identified by name, date of birth, etc, in the provisions of the Will, that is sufficient.
